logo

Output 451384734fd8d46d512921ef189420e6aa9893c65c4d504b44523cb93a882f1e:1

value
638908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 022b87d5dd735c5117c96fed36778b9e6ccc8a52 OP_EQUAL
address
31tVRVCajA9CV2FAViTrun4AH975EhUnKM
transaction
451384734fd8d46d512921ef189420e6aa9893c65c4d504b44523cb93a882f1e